Your registered phone number is your unique identity on Boro Jeet. It links your login, your OTPs, and your bKash/Nagad wallet.
Because it's so important (tied to your KYC Verification), you cannot change it in the Profile Settings.
This prevents hackers from stealing your account and changing the number to their own.
The Only Way to Change It: Live Chat
You must prove to the Customer Support team that you are the real owner.
Step 1: Prepare Verification Documents
Before you start the chat, have these ready:
- Old Number: The one currently on the account.
- New Number: The one you want to use (Must NOT be registered on Boro Jeet before).
- NID Card: Front and back photo.
- Last Deposit Proof: A screenshot of your last bKash/Nagad transaction ID.

Step 2: The Request Script
Open Live Chat and use this script:
"Hello, I lost my SIM card (Old Number: 017XXXXXXX). I need to update my account to my New Number (019XXXXXXX). I have my ID and deposit proof ready."
Step 3: SMS Verification
The agent will call or SMS your NEW number to verify it is active in your hand.
Once verified, they will update the system. This usually takes 14-48 hours.
Why Was My Request Rejected?
- Number Already Used: The new number is already linked to another Boro Jeet account (even an old one). You cannot recycle numbers.
- Security Mismatch: Your NID name does not match the account name.
- Active Bet: You cannot change details while a bet is live. Wait for it to settle.
